Walk up the stairs. Rather than using an elevator, walk up the stairs to the floor you live or work on. This isn't as simple to do if you work on a very high floor but if you work on a lower floor, utilizing the stairs is a superb way to get some extra exercise. Even if you do live or work on one of the higher floors, you can still get off of the elevator first and climb up the stairs the rest of the way. Lots of people choose the easy elevator ride instead of making an attempt on the stairs. Even just a sole flight of stairs, when walked up or down a few times a day--can be a great boost to your system.

The ingredients needed to prepare Dum Aloo:

  1. Provide 20-25 of baby potatoes (boiled).
  2. Prepare 3/4 cup of curd.
  3. Prepare 2 medium of onion chopped.
  4. Take 1 tsp of ginger paste.
  5. Provide 1 tsp of garlic paste.
  6. Prepare 2 tbsp of Coriander seeds.
  7. Take 1 tsp of fennel seeds.
  8. Get 1 tsp+1/2 tsp of cumin seeds.
  9. Get 1 of bay leaf.
  10. Provide 2 of green cardamoms.
  11. You need 1 inch of cinnamon stick.
  12. You need 1 of cloves.
  13. Use 2 tbsp of roasted peanuts.
  14. Provide 1 pinch of asafoetida.
  15. Use 1 tsp of red chilli powder.
  16. Provide 1/4 tsp of turmeric powder.
  17. Get 1 tsp of kasuri methi.
  18. Provide 4 tbsp of oil.
  19. Provide as per taste of Salt.
  20. Get as required of Water.

Steps to make Dum Aloo:

  1. First, take Coriander seeds, clove, cinnamon, fennel seeds, 1 tsp cumin seeds, and peanuts.put in a grinder jar and grind together and make a fine powder. Keep aside.
  2. In a kadhai, add oil heat it add boiled potatoes and fry them on medium flame untill they turn golden brown. Transfer in a plate..
  3. In the same oil add asafoetida, cumin seeds and bay leaf saute few seconds add chopped onion saute and cooked until they turn golden brown add ginger garlic paste saute.Add grind masala mix well and cook for 2 minutes. Then turn the flame low add curd and mix.add turmeric and chili powder mix well. cover and cook for 2-3 minutes. when masala releases the oil add fry potatoes, Kasuri methi, and salt mix together.add one cup water cover and cook for 8-10 minutes on medium flame.Turn off the flame..
  4. Garnish with coriander leaves and serve with roti or paratha..
